Wig Stylist
Role: Wig Stylist
Location: London, UK
Type: Part-Time, 21 Hours, 3 days per week (Mon, Fri & Sat)
Pay: Up to £13.00 per hour
About us:
Chrissy Bales is an internationally renowned wig brand in London with our flagship studio in St Johns Wood.
We are professional, agile, customer-centric, and our goal is to provide an exceptional luxury experience to our clientele.
We are looking for an experienced wig stylist to join the Chrissy Bales team, contribute to our continued success and deliver consistently exceptional service for our loyal client base.
What we require you to do:
- Wash and condition wigs using professional products
- Cut, trim and style wigs using professional equipment
- Apply hair treatment products to wigs, as needed (e.g. colour protection creams and hydrating masks)
- Apply a wide range of hair colouring techniques (e.g. highlights, ombre and balayage)
- Create various hairstyles dependent on the clients specification
- Prep and style client's hair, where necessary (e.g. cornrows)
- Cross-sell hair care products or services, when appropriate
- Ensure tidiness of beauty stations and sterilise tools, as needed
- Staying up-to-date with the latest trends, hairstyles and products
- Maintaining an adequate inventory of hair products and tools
Skills and experience required:
- Minimum of 3 years experience as a professional wig stylist/maker
- Proficiency in hair straightening and curling methods, using hot irons and curlers
- Hands-on experience with various colouring techniques
- Knowledge of a wide range of hairstyles, suitable for various lengths & textures
- Up-to-date with industry trends
- Excellent interpersonal & communication skills
- Physical stamina to stand for long hours
